Cashroom Assistant - Transactional Finance

Are you good with numbers and enjoy working as part of a busy team

Were looking for a Cashroom Assistant - Transactional to join our Finance team in Edinburgh or Glasgow. Youll help in the smooth and efficient operation of our cashroom service - handling a variety of requests for incoming and outgoing funds ensuring confidentiality accuracy and integrity of our data is maintained.

This role will allow you to work with everyone in the firm - from fee earners to business services functions and also engage with our clients.

Were looking for someone with previous cashroom or finance assistant experience within a professional services environment. The key aspect of this role is the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ment and keep calm under pressure this is crucial for managing the volume and value of transactions we handle.
